The OXO Steel Bottle Brush features a long, flexible neck and dual-function nylon bristles that combine tough scrubbing with gentle cleaning, perfect for bottles, glassware, and delicate containers. Its non-slip handle includes a stainless steel accent and is made from 97% recycled materials. The replaceable twist-on brush heads extend product life, making it an eco-friendly, durable cleaning essential trusted by thousands.

The last bottle brush I’ll need—until I twist on a fresh head
I’ve cycled through plenty of cheap brushes that either couldn’t reach the bottom of my 32-oz Hydro Flask or turned limp after a month. Two weeks with the OXO Steel Bottle Brush with Replaceable Head and I’m officially upgrading: this thing is built to last and actually gets every corner clean. Why it earned a permanent spot by my sink • Long, flexible neck snakes to the bottom of coffee carafes, wine decanters, and my narrow-neck water bottle without forcing my wrist into weird angles. • Two textures of bristles in one head. The stiff tip scrubs dried smoothie sludge, while the softer side bristles baby my crystal stemware. No more switching tools mid-wash. • Non-slip handle that still looks classy. The stainless-steel accent dresses up my sink caddy, and the grippy core stays secure even when my hands are soapy. • Twist-off heads = less waste. When the bristles finally wear out I’ll replace a brush head instead of tossing the whole brush—plus the black core is 97 % recycled plastic. Minor quirks (so you’re not surprised) 1. Replacement heads sold separately. I wish OXO included one extra in the box, but at least they’re easy to find. 2. A bit heftier than plastic brushes. The steel core feels luxe, yet adds weight—fine for me, but worth noting if you prefer ultra-light tools. 3. Not for ultra-slim necks (<¾”). It fits my narrow bottles, but anything skinnier than a standard soda bottle will need a straw brush. Pro tips • Keep a spare head on hand. It twists off in two seconds—perfect when you switch from greasy cast-iron to baby gear and don’t want cross-contamination. • Use the flex. Insert the brush, then gently bend the neck so the stiff tip hits the very bottom edge; the angled pressure lifts caked-on protein shake residue fast. • Store upright. Hang it by the handle hole or stand it in a caddy to let bristles air-dry and stay odor-free. * Verdict * For roughly the price of a movie ticket, you get a brush that looks premium, cleans anything you throw at it, and won’t end up in a landfill after a single season. If your current brush can’t hit the corners—or if you’re tired of tossing the whole thing when it frays—do yourself (and the planet) a favor and pick this one up. I’ll happily twist on fresh heads for years to come.
